Design and Capacity
The Cuisinart 7-Cup Food Processor has a significantly larger capacity compared to the Proctor Silex Mini Food Processor. With a 7-cup work bowl, it is designed for bigger tasks and meal prep, making it ideal for families or those who frequently cook in larger batches. In contrast, the Proctor Silex has a compact 1.5-cup capacity, which is perfect for everyday small tasks like chopping onions or making salsa.
The sleek and modern design of the Cuisinart not only looks appealing but also offers two easy control buttons for On and Pulse/Off, ensuring user-friendly operation. On the other hand, the Proctor Silex focuses on practicality and efficiency, making it a great choice for quick jobs without the need for a large machine. This stark difference in design and capacity caters to different cooking styles and needs.
Performance and Versatility
When it comes to performance, the Cuisinart 7-Cup Food Processor excels with its universal blade that can chop, mix, and even handle dough. It also features reversible shredding and slicing discs, allowing users to prepare a variety of ingredients quickly. This versatility makes it suitable for preparing snacks, sauces, meals, and desserts, enabling users to tackle multiple tasks in one go.
Conversely, the Proctor Silex focuses on basic chopping, pureeing, and emulsifying tasks. Its stainless steel blades efficiently cut through various ingredients, but it is limited compared to the multifunctionality of the Cuisinart. While the Proctor Silex is excellent for smaller prep jobs, the Cuisinart is the more powerful option for those who need a reliable kitchen workhorse capable of handling a wider range of culinary tasks.

Cleaning and Maintenance
Cleaning the Cuisinart 7-Cup Food Processor may require a bit more effort due to its larger components, but it provides a thorough and efficient food prep experience. Although it is easy to clean, the additional parts may require more time to wash and organize compared to a simpler unit.
The Proctor Silex shines in this category, as all its components—the bowl, lid, and removable blades—are dishwasher safe. This feature makes it exceptionally easy to maintain, especially for those who do not want to spend time hand-washing kitchen gadgets. The compact design also means fewer parts to clean, which is a significant advantage for quick, everyday cooking tasks.
